Cats in the White House

Dogs aren’t the only animals to be dubbed "first" in the White House, as several presidents have had cats in the Oval Office, too. Here is a complete list of the names of all felines that have lived at 1600 Pennsylvania Avenue.
Martin Van Buren: 8th U.S. President (1837-1841)
Unnamed Tiger cubs
Theodore Roosevelt: 26th U.S. President (1901-1909)
Tom Quartz
Slippers
Woodrow Wilson: 28th U.S. President (1913-1921)
Puffins
Calvin Coolidge: 30th U.S. President (1923-1929)
Budget Bureau (Lion cub)
Smoky (Bobcat)
Tax Reduction (Lion cub)
Tiger
John F. Kennedy: 35th U.S. President (1961-1963)
Tom Kitten
Gerald Ford: 38th U.S. President (1974-1977)
Shan (Siamese)
Jimmy Carter: 39th U.S. President (1977-1981)
Misty Malarky Ying Yang (Siamese)
Bill Clinton: 42nd U.S. President (1993-2001)
Socks (First Cat of the United States)
George W. Bush: 43rd U.S. President (2001-2009)
India "Willie"
